We aren't in a development year. We're in a year where we should be competing for the flag.
Eddy is 27 years old and was selected as a mature age recruit. He's as ready as he ever will be, barring some natural fitness improvement. Howard has previously been selected in the side, and is fit and moving well after recovering from injury.
We're currently playing a defender who isn't a natural forward by any stretch as a 2nd KPF and it is actively costing us a top 4 spot at the moment and might cost us a flag. It's not Jackson's fault, it's a list management f***up, but we all recognise that he isn't working as a forward. Players are ready because they are in form in the reserves and we need to fill their position in the AFL side.
These aren't green, 18yo first year beanpoles. Both are more than capable of playing a role in our side and both would improve our forward line right now.
Ken needs to be sacked because he's throwing away a chance at winning a flag because he's too gutless and pigheaded to move his tall players around to accomodate the natural KPF we're crying out for.
